Tracking Reading Proficiency in Finnish School Children: A Comprehensive Approach to Component Skill Assessment and Development

Recent PISA results reveal a concerning decline in reading skills in Finland, with growing disparities linked to gender and linguistic background. Our project tackles these challenges by developing new assessment tools for key reading and self-regulation skills, including vocabulary, morphology, grammar, reading motivation and strategies. We are tracking the development of these skills and their relation to reading comprehension in thousands of native and non-native Finnish pupils from grade 1 to 9. Additionally, we aim to provide personalized interventions for students struggling with specific skills. Central to our project is using the ViLLE learning platform, which enables us to collect data from 25,000 students annually. The project provides educators with free, research-based tools to monitor reading progress and support pupils with reading challenges. It is thus well suited to reverse the decline in reading skills while bridging gaps related to gender and home language background
